Why These Are the Top Plumbing Contractors in Bloomery

Bloomery is a small, unincorporated community in Hampshire County, WV, with a rural character. The plumbing market is served by regional contractors from nearby towns like Charles Town and Romney. Common issues include aging well systems, septic tank problems, frozen pipes in winter, and repairs for older home plumbing. Properties often rely on well water and private septic systems, requiring specialists familiar with pumps, pressure tanks, and drain fields. The limited local population means most providers are mobile and service a wide geographic area.
